Baqueira Beret is a complete resort, divided in 3 areas: Beret, Baqueira, and Bonaiqua with their respective characteristics, a network of modern installations and carefully maintained pistes, will satisfy all skiers. Baqueira, the pioneer, inaugurated in 1964, has a wide range o f pistes suitable for all levels but it’s also the resort with most black pistes. The experts will, thus, come across some greatly dis-levelled pistes, mostly on the north side, guaranteeing the excellent quality of the snow. Some famous one are: Luis Arias, Eth Mur, Tubo Neve and the Escornacrables. Beret is idea l for beginners and families. You’ll have easy access, by foot from the parking, to all amenities ( restaurants, cafeteria, school, etc..). Its pistes are very wide and of moderate inclination. Although, paradoxically, it is there that the permanent Stadium hosting competitions of high level is located. Snowboarders will also be able to enjoy a snowpark in this area of the resort. Bonaigua is the zone with more spades and possess two highly recommendable itineraries: Lo Boscas and Gerber. All amenities is on foot distance by road. Baqueira, Beret and Bonaigua all dispose cafeterias, restaurants, bars, nurseries and ski schools. In Baqueira Beret the most important is skiing in all its aspects but that’s not all. There’s an endless list of activities to occupy you during the day: dog-pulled sled treks, snowshoeing excursions, heliski, etc. If Baqueira a beret has always put an emphasis on the highest quality of services, Val d’Aran wasn’t left behind. Of an extraordinary beauty, this valley always surprises first-time visitors who didn’t expect such an alpine landscape in Spain.It managed to retain its traditional architecture, stone and wooden houses with their slated roofs, That tradition has been kept in more modern construct ions. All its small villages with roman churches deserve to be visited. Its choice of hotels is excellent and the apres-ski activities are endless: Ice palaces, thermal baths, museums, cultural visits, cinema, golf, horse rides, bars and discos. A special mention should be given to catering in Val d’Aran. No other place offers such an extensive range of choice, more than 200 restaurants serving a cuisine with a clear French influence (the valley borders with France) but also Basque, Catalan and local, the latter being better represented in La Olla Aranessa, is a must for the visitors of this land.

For a complete experience on and off the slopes, the ultra-modern ski station and stylish purpose-built resort of Formigal is the perfect choice. Formigal is the largest, most complete ski-station in the entire Pyrenees with 105.5 kilometres of slopes and itineraries served by the latest advances in ski resort technology. Ideal for the beginner and the expert skier alike, the modern ski facilities provide some of the best skiing in the Pyrenees. The immaculately groomed pistes, with unsurpassable levels of safety and comfort, are equipped with a high-capacity lift system and the comfortable hands-free lift passes incorporate a system which prevents inadvertent access to slopes beyond the abilities of the skier. In the search for excellence, Formigal constantly updates its facilities and activities to offer all the latest trends in winter sports. This season, for the more daring, the new Bordercross area has marked tracks with banked turns for the exhilaration of high-speed competitive descent and the Snowpark, opened in 2005/2006, caters for snowboarders. From the adrenalin-charged experience of driving a dog-sled or skidoo to enjoying a drink on the panoramic sun-deck, there is something for everyone in Formigal. There are original and entertaining activities such as the Nanook experience or hands-on activities for children and families, and the unique experience of night skiing. Formigal is a resort with the atmosphere of a traditional mountain village where modern 4-star hotels blend in with the traditional local architecture. Inside there are magnificent suites overlooking the slopes, gourmet restaurants and extensive wine cellars. The exclusive spa facilities and heated swimming pools provide a relaxing atmosphere to pamper yourself in the lap of luxury. The welcoming atmosphere of the 3-star hotels is perfect for families, providing connecting rooms, supervised activities and menus with both children and adults in mind. The key to Formigal’s success is its privileged situation. A stone’s throw from the slopes means that a skiing holiday can be combined with winery visits and wine-tasting, a round of golf on an Olazábal-designed golf course, excursions to local places of interest and picture-postcard beauty, LaCuniacha wildlife park, ice skating and shopping trips.

A hidden gem of the Pyrenees, Panticosa was the traditional mountain retreat for the rich and influential of Spanish society in the nineteenth and early twentieth century. The unspoilt harmony of the traditional mountain architecture of the village itself and the stately silhouettes of the spa complex give an air of grandeur and history to the valley. A five-minute cable car ride from the heart of this peaceful setting at 1,160 metres to an altitude of 1,900 metres reveals a jealously guarded secret: a modern ski-station equipped with the latest technological advances. Panticosa is proud of its facilities and to avoid saturation of the ski-station there is a limit of 3,500 visitors per day. The on-piste facilities include a nursery and a pizza restaurant with panoramic views of the slopes, bar, cafeteria, ski-hire shop and a boutique with the latest in skiwear design. Accommodation ranges from luxurious four and five-star hotels in the spa complex to three-star, family-run hotels where the personal attention makes the guest feel at home. The nearby ski-station of Formigal provides additional options such as dog-sled and skidoo rides.

Sierra Nevada defies many concepts associated with skiing. Located at barely a stone’s throw from the Mediterranean coast, it has practically guaranteed sunshine, the best spring snow conditions in Europe and is still reasonably priced compared to many of its European counterparts. As one of Europe's highest resorts it has a typically long season, traditionally opening at the end of November running through to the end of April or even into the first week of May. Sierra Nevada literally means "Snowy Mountain Range" and includes some of the highest peaks in Europe not to mention the highest concentration of peaks over 3,000m in the country. The Mulhacen, at 3,482m, is Spain's highest after Mount Teide in Tenerife. The ski terrain is majestically overlooked by the glacier formed jagged peak of Veleta at 3,398m, Spain's third highest after Aneto, (3,404m), in the Pyrenees. The ski resort of Sierra Nevada offers its visitors a wide and ever expanding range of facilities as well as a ski terrain to suit skiers & boarders of all standards. Families will enjoy quality hotel accommodation as well as child facilities such as the recently developed Mirlo Blanco recreation zone comprising of activities such as Ski Bike, Inner Tubing, Ice Skating and the new “Roller-Sled”. The creche and Snow Garden are well run establishments with fully trained staff to look after children up to 7 years old. The Sierra Nevada offers 79 slopes with a total of 84 skiable kilometres. The most southern ski station in Europe proudly counts 8 green slopes (easy), 33 blue slopes (intermediate) and 34 red (advanced) and black (difficult) slopes. Everyone will find the right terrain for his personal level and taste.
